Output 35401255c75dd9010e0eb0b5d53dba81feeea4ec894955a233c5d9e453173c76:0

value
1667273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 105d36c8c5dbd563a81bb14f7fb2b11759bdbc55 OP_EQUAL
address
33BYQEc4QrpiRTaVT7aHnapDt8eHLfJY5o
transaction
35401255c75dd9010e0eb0b5d53dba81feeea4ec894955a233c5d9e453173c76
spent
true